    Are you sure it's mirror, or just very shiny? It it's just reflective, there are several people who make it, namely Rowmark. I use it for sign component pieces in a couple of offices I do work for. You can see yourself in it just fine, but it's not a "mirror" so to speak.

    I don't engrave on it, I only vector cut the shapes for the signs, but it does have the black secondary surface and it is engravable.
